#229172 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#229172 is composed of 13.3% red, 56.9%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.4%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 163.2 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 35.1%. #229172 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ffe4 with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#229172 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#229172 has RGB values of R:34, G:145,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2265458.

Shades and Tints of #229172
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#229172
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595a5a is the less saturated color, while #06ad7e is the most saturated one.
